Industrial processes often require precise and accurate dosing of chemicals to ensure efficient and effective operations. One essential tool for achieving this level of precision is the dosing pump chemical. These pumps are designed to deliver a controlled amount of chemical substances into a process or system, ensuring that the desired concentration is maintained at all times.

Dosing pumps play a crucial role in a wide range of industries, including water treatment, agriculture, pharmaceuticals, and manufacturing. They are commonly used for dosing chemicals such as chlorine, acids, alkalis, polymers, and coagulants. The ability to accurately control the flow rate of these chemicals is vital for maintaining the integrity of the process and achieving the desired results.

One of the key advantages of dosing pump chemicals is their ability to deliver precise and consistent doses over an extended period. This level of accuracy is essential in industries where even slight variations in chemical concentrations can have a significant impact on the outcome of the process. Dosing pumps can be programmed to dispense chemicals at a specific rate, allowing operators to maintain tight control over the dosing process.

Another benefit of using dosing pump chemicals is their ability to handle a wide range of chemicals with varying viscosities and corrosive properties. Many dosing pumps are designed with materials that are resistant to corrosion and can withstand aggressive chemical environments. This versatility makes dosing pumps an ideal choice for industries that work with a diverse range of chemicals.

When it comes to selecting a dosing pump chemical, there are several factors to consider. The type of chemical being dosed, the desired flow rate, and the specific requirements of the process will all influence the choice of pump. Some dosing pumps are designed for precise dosing of small volumes, while others are capable of delivering larger quantities over a longer period.

It is essential to select a dosing pump that is reliable, durable, and easy to maintain. Regular maintenance and calibration are essential to ensure that the pump continues to operate at peak performance. Many dosing pumps are equipped with features such as self-priming capabilities, automatic shut-off, and remote monitoring to streamline maintenance tasks and minimize downtime.
